The BSPCA is a charitable organization in existence since 1874. Its purpose is to prevent cruelty to animals and provide help and relief to all animals in Mumbai city. The animal hospital works 24 hours a day and treats an average of about 400 animals per day which includes different species of animals. know more:

Rescue Operations

Inspectors of the Bombay SPCA's Field Force recently raided pet shops in the Crawford Market area. They discovered illegal wildlife being kept in terrible conditions . Very young parakeets bundled into a bag and also squashed into a box. Several turtles were found, piled one on top of another, in a bag. The poor creatures were confiscated and and are now recovering at the BSPCA hospital. The shop owners were charge sheeted.
